While pain relief pills can be efficient, they may also carry the threat of negative effects. Below is a list of common negative effects for both OTC and prescription painkiller.
Over-the-Counter Pain RelieversAspirin: Stomach upset, intestinal bleeding, allergic responsesIbuprofen: Nausea, headache, stomach pain, increased threat of heart attack/stroke with long-term useAcetaminophen: Liver damage with overdose, allergic reactionsPrescription Pain RelieversOpioids: Addiction, constipation, breathing anxiety, sedationMuscle Relaxants: Drowsiness, lightheadedness, dependency with prolonged usage
Note: Always seek advice from a healthcare expert before starting or stopping any medication, particularly prescription drugs, to minimize threats and optimize safety.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are all pain relief pills ideal for everybody?
Not all pain relief medications are ideal for everybody. Factors such as age, other health conditions, and possible drug interactions must be thought about. Constantly seek advice from a doctor.
2. How frequently can I take pain relief pills?
OTC medications normally have standards on dose frequency. Nevertheless, prescription medications must be taken according to a medical professional's directions to avoid problems.
3. Can I mix different painkiller?
Some combinations are safe (e.g., Acetaminophen and Ibuprofen), however others can be dangerous. Seek advice from a healthcare professional before blending medications.
